Excerpt: ... WEBSTER'S REPLY TO IIAYNE. Delivered in the United States Senate, January 26, 1830. Following Mr. Hayne in the debate, Mr. Webstee addressed the Senate as follows: Mr. Pkesident: When the mariner has been tossed, for many days, in thick weather, and on an unknown sea, he naturally avails himself of the first pause in the storm, the earliest glance of the sun, to take his latitude, and ascertain how far the elements have driven him from his true course. Let us imitate this prudence, and before we float farther, refer to the point from which we departed, that we may at least be able to conjecture where wo now are. I ask for the reading of the resolution. The secretary read the resolution as follows: 'Resolved, Thae committeeon public lands be instructed to inquire and 'veSfpfyjie-.quanty of the public lands remaining unsold within each State and Territory, anwhether it be expedient to limit, for a certain period, the sales of the public lands to such lands only as have heretofore been offered for sale, and are now subject to entry at the minimum price. And, also, whether the office of surveyor-general, and some of the land offices, may not bj abolished without detriment to the public interest; or whether it be expedient to adopt measures to hasten the sales, and extend more rapidly the surveys of the public lands." We have thus heard, Sir, what the resolution is, which is actually before us for consideration; and it will readily occur to every one that it is almost the only subject about which something has not been said in the speech, running through two days, by which the Senate has been now entertained by the gentleman from South Carolina.
